Safety


If properly controlled If they are properly supervised, bunk beds can be an excellent sleeping solution for kids. It is important to establish guidelines to ensure your children are safe in their bunk beds. These guidelines can include not hanging objects from bunk beds (such as scarves, belts or jump ropes) since they can are strangulation hazards and ensuring that kids use the bed solely as a place to sleep. Bunk beds can also be dangerous, so kids must always use the ladder with care.

If you are buying a bunkbed, make sure it has been tested and cleared by an independent lab. It should also meet or surpass US safety standards. The guard rails should be positioned high enough on the top bunk to prevent the child from falling off. Also, make sure there are no gaps that could cause a child's head and limb to get caught. It is a good idea to buy a bunk bed that has built-in shelves or integrated ones on the top bunk. This will provide your children with a place to keep items that they may need at night, like a clock, books, and drinks. There are also light fixtures that clip on that easily attach to the railings on the top bunk, so your kids can enjoy a light without needing to leave their bed at the end of the night.

It's best to keep younger children on the bottom bunk, as they are less likely to have the coordination required to safely climb the ladder to the top bunk. Older children might be able to sleep on the top bunk but it's a good idea to remind them regularly to use the ladder carefully and to avoid playing on or around the bed. If your children are using the top bunk, you must also teach them to take away hazardous objects from the bed and to always keep the bunks from any ceiling fans within reach.

Space Saving

Bunk beds can expand the vertical space of a room to the maximum, providing more floor space for kids to play or study. They're also a great choice for rooms that share a space that allow siblings to sleep side by side in comfort, without sacrificing their privacy or the room's overall design.

It is possible to compromise when selecting the right bunk bed for your children. If your children aren't yet ready to the top bunk, you might want to consider a low or loft bunk design that puts one mattress on the ground, and another one above. This design makes it easier for children of younger ages to get in and out of bed. However, older kids can still take pleasure in the excitement of sleeping higher up.

If you're deciding on a bunk bed for your children, make sure the stairs or ladder are sturdy and safe. You don't want a ladder that is too small or wobbly for your children, as they can be rough when used with furniture. Find a design with guardrails along the sides of beds, and angled ladders to ensure safety as well as an elevated step-up that is low to the ground so that it's easy for even small kids to reach.

If your kids are both vying for the top bunk, opt for a configuration that allows one child to sleep on the top, to avoid a fight. You can also choose the corner bunk which combines two beds elevated in one corner of the room. This will keep everyone happy and allow more room to play or study.
